The UN-Habitat, United Nations Human Settlements Programme is providing the opportunity for internships at its Fukuoka Office location. Currently, internships are not available within the context of field projects unless with special permission by UN-HABITAT headquarters.

Candidates for Internships MUST
- Apply online at www.unon.org or direct to UN-HABITAT ROAP.
- Forward letters from your academic institutions confirming when you will complete your degree. Note: To be eligible, the potential intern has to be currently enrolled in their third year or fourth year of undergraduate studies, pursuing a masters or PHD and need to be enrolled throughout the period of internship.
- Obtain an endorsement from the Nominating/Sponsoring Institution. The intern or sponsoring Government or institution bears all costs connected with the internship such as costs and arrangements for travel, visa, accommodation, transportation, medical, insurance, living expenses, etc. The intern is also responsible for all necessary arrangement regarding visas and other documents that are needed for his/her stay.
- Provide proof of valid major medical insurance coverage and medical certificate of good health.
- Be willing to intern on a Full-Time basis spending five days a week usually for a period of not less than THREE MONTHS and not exceeding SIX MONTHS, and adhere to the office working hours.
- Fluent in English (Working knowledge of another UN language or Japanese an asset)
Other important note:
- •The intern is not eligible to apply or appointed to any posts in the UN during the period of the internship or for the 6 months immediately following the expiration thereof.
- •Interns are considered gratis personnel and not staff members.
- •Interns should be supervised by the UN staff members, not consultants or other personnel contracted to specific programmes/projects.
Internships are available in the following areas
- Administration / Finance
- Information Technology
- Public information / Conference Services
- Research (Various Areas)
Please note that the intern WILL NOT BE REMUNERATED by the UN. Transportation to and from the UN must be borne by the candidate or his/her sponsoring institution. Also, there is NO EXPECTANCY OF EMPLOYMENT at the end of the internship.
